>>> >> On 19 June 2012 00:09, sidbatra <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
>>> >> This turns out to be a genuine bug with an easy fix.
>>> >>
>>> >> build.xml is configured to generate a job file titled
>>> "apache-nutch-1.5.job"
>>> >> but the deploy binary is still looking for "nutch-1.5.job"
>>> >>
>>> >>
>>> >> Renaming "apache-nutch-1.5.job" to "nutch-1.5.job" fixes this bug in
>>> deploy
>>> >> mode.
